CIVIC CABARET
Patrons of the Civic Cabaret will be entertained for the first time to-night by the popular Molly Byron, who will appear in vocal and dancing numbers. The latest music will be provided by the new Civic orchestra under the conductor shift of Mr. Ted Healy.
